James Monroe Bank Is Regional Pioneer for Health Savings Accounts
James Monroe Bank (NASDAQ: JMBI) today
announced it is offering Health Savings Accounts (HSA accounts).
Commercial clients with high-deductible health care plans can offer
employees an effective way to save for future qualified medical and retiree
health expenses while lowering company costs related to healthcare.

One of the most popular aspects of HSA accounts is their pre-tax
deductibility and "roll-over", or portability feature. Unlike commonly
known "use-it-or-lose-it" flex spending accounts, deposits in HSA accounts
are lifetime in nature. Once deposits are made they are the property of
the account holder, not the employer, and available anytime. Also, the
accounts are portable, meaning deposits can be directed from any employer
offering the service. If an account holder changes jobs, funds can be
directed from the new employer into the same account.
HSA's were signed into law by President Bush and made available January 1,
2004. James Monroe's HSA account will be interest-bearing. HSA customers
will be issued a free HSA debit card and free initial checks enabling the
account holder to pay for deductibles, co-payments, and other qualified
medical expenses by check or by debit card. Special educational seminars
